Bacillus cereus is a type of bacteria that can cause food poisoning. It is commonly found in soil and dust, and can contaminate food through contact with contaminated surfaces or equipment. Bacillus cereus can cause two types of food poisoning: diarrheal and emetic. Diarrheal food poisoning is the most common type, and symptoms include diarrhea, abdominal cramps, and nausea. Emetic food poisoning is less common, and symptoms include vomiting, nausea, and abdominal pain.
